BILLIE GEDDES It is with great sadness and deep sorrow that we announce the passing of our mother, Billie Geddes, on October 7, 2000 at the Swan Valley Hospital, at the age of 79 years. Billie will be remembered by son Bob (Louise), daughter Cindi (Howard) Krisjansson; grandchildren, Jason (Tanis), Melanie, Kalvin, Daniel, and great-grandson Joey. She was predeceased by her husband Percy, and daughter Gaylene and her sister Inez Mault. Left to mourn is her brother Wally (Nettie) Wolpert of Vernon, and her sister Beryl Clement of Winnipeg, also numerous nieces and nephews. Mom was born and spent most of her adult life in Swan River. She worked for many years at the Crescent Creamery and later the Co-op Creamery where she retired in 1983. Mom and dad spent their retirement winter years in Victoria. Mom was a devoted wife, mother and wonderful grandmother. She loved baking for her family, having coffee with her friends and in her younger years she curled. She will be sadly missed by all.
